Slumdog Millionaire-My review







A film that bagged 4 awards.A hollywood film totally based out of india especially mumbai.All the cast who acted are Indians.A film not only made an indian to win the scholarly GOLDENGLOBE award but also made the entire nation proud...Should i have to give any other clues about this film....I am talking about the film "Slumdog Millionaire" which is based out of the book "Q and A" by Vikas Swaroop...



This film directed by Danny Boyle and co-directed by Loveleen Tandon is one of the film which we hear/read in the form of reviews in newspapers,magazines etc....To add one more feather to its beauty our own prodigy ARR is the music director,who bagged the Golden globe award for his fantabulous music.

The main leads of this movie are Jamal(Dev patel),Saleem(Mathur Mittal) and Lathika(Freida Pinto)...Jamal participates in the show"Who wants to be a millionaire"Jamal a slumdog who answers all the questions and reaches the last question to bag 20 million rupees..Anil kapoor is the host and he is completely astonished to see a slumdog answering the questions...

Jamal is arrested by the police Irfan Khan fearing that he had cheated to win the contest...The flashback starts from here..Jamal explains how each question have relevance with his life..Also he misses his brother Saleem and his lovely sweetheart Lathika..Did he meet his brother and Lathika.Did he win the contest,to find the answers for all these questions you have to watch the movie....

The communal attack,the life of people @slums are beautifully protrayed in the movie And finally the song "JAI HO" is a fantastic number i would say..I hear this song umpteen times but never feel bored ,I guess that is the magic of ARR.
